Description:
2-Phenylpropionic acid, with the CAS number 492-37-5, is an aromatic carboxylic acid characterized by its phenyl group attached to a propionic acid backbone. This compound typically appears as a white to off-white crystalline solid and is known for its moderate solubility in water, while being more soluble in organic solvents such as ethanol and ether. It has a melting point that generally falls within a specific range, indicating its solid state at room temperature. The presence of both a carboxylic acid functional group and an aromatic ring contributes to its chemical reactivity, allowing it to participate in various organic reactions, including esterification and amidation. 2-Phenylpropionic acid is also recognized for its potential applications in pharmaceuticals and as a building block in organic synthesis. Additionally, it exhibits anti-inflammatory properties, making it of interest in medicinal chemistry. Safety data indicates that, like many organic acids, it should be handled with care to avoid irritation or adverse reactions.
Formula:C9H10O2
InChI:InChI=1S/C9H10O2/c1-7(9(10)11)8-5-3-2-4-6-8/h2-7H,1H3,(H,10,11)
InChI key:InChIKey=YPGCWEMNNLXISK-UHFFFAOYSA-N
SMILES:C(C(O)=O)(C)C1=CC=CC=C1
